Grab some chips and dig into the superb and offbeat salsa (it has a slightly smoky flavor). It's good enough that you will go for a second ration, for which you will have to pay extra--but probably without complaint. Margaritas and guacamole are excellent in their turns. After that, pretend you're in a gourmet bistro. Time for mussels, calamari, steaks, racks of lamb, big flanks of fish, and no small number of other specialties that might not remind you of anything Mexican. But so what? We let Italian and French restaurants get away with that. So why not Creole-Mexican?
